It's thought the boats had been used by immigrants.
Three empty patera small 4.5 metre boats have been found on the Redonda beach in Torrevieja.
The remains of some food and clothing were found in the boats yesterday morning leading to the conclusion that they had indeed been used by immigrants.
The boats had small outboard motors of between 25 and 40 horse power, and have now been removed from the scene by the authorities.
It’s thought that the boats were carrying some 30 people, and so far the Guardia Civil say they have arrested three men from Algeria.
Meanwhile in Murcia another four boats have been intercepted and at least 37 immigrants arrested.
